WASHINGTON, Sept. 12, 2012 /PRNewswire-USNewswire/ -- "The Families of Pan Am 103/Lockerbie sends its heartfelt condolences to the families of Ambassador Stevens and the other US diplomats killed in Libya yesterday by unknown assailants on September 11th, the 11th anniversary of the worst terrorist attack against Americans in history. We know the pain, shock, grief, and anger, having lost 270 of our loved ones in the 1988 bombing carried out by Gaddafi regime terrorists over Lockerbie Scotland, the second most deadly terrorist attack against American civilians in history," stated Paul Hudson, president of the Families' group.
"Nothing can bring them back, but as President Obama promised today, Justice Must Be Done: For all those murdered by terrorists. Accordingly, we call on the Libyan Government to not only denounce these latest senseless murders of Americans but to swiftly bring those responsible to justice and to fulfill its long promised but so far unmet commitments to the UN and the US to fully cooperate in the criminal investigations of the Pan Am 103 and UTA bombings (that killed 440 innocent civilians including 195 Americans and wife of another US ambassador) as well as numerous other terrorist killings carried out or supported by the Gaddafi regime over several decades. "
Next week, family members of Pan Am 103 victims will gather in Washington, DC to meet with members of Congress and the Obama Administration to urge concrete action for the long delayed justice for terrorist victims of the Gaddafi regime terrorism.
